Jealousies Shape Fire Pro Controversy Over Theater Safeguards

The dispute pits Marshal Gardner Kellogg against M Ralph Cook over proposed theater fire safeguards. Cook argues chief’s regulations burden owners, while Kellogg has opposed similar rules in the past. The ordinance would require theater owners to install safeguards and follow performance directives, signaling a broader clash between city officials and theater owners.

Death Comes Suddenly to County Auditor Candidate John Haigh

John W. Haigh a democratic nominee for county auditor and editor of Forest Echoes collapsed on a sidewalk at First Avenue and Bell Street at 11 46 last night. He died at Way side Emergency Hospital at 3 this morning from heart trouble. He leaves a wife and four children and resided at 314 Third Avenue North. Autopsy planned. funeral arrangements pending. he was about 40 years old.

Indicted Again in Land Fraud Case Involving Mitchell and Hermann

Federal grand jury in Portland returned four indictments charging seventeen individuals with criminal complicity in land frauds. Senator J. H. Mitchell and Congressman Binger Hermann are named again with the same bribe and conspiracy charges as in the prior indictment, this time due to a technical flaw that may lead to the first indictment being quashed.

Revenge Motive Cited in Third Avenue Hall Explosion

Police seek a gambler tied to a Sunday night blast at a long known meeting hall on Third Avenue. Revenge follows a losses of nearly $3,000 weeks earlier in the back room gambling den. Lessees and Patrol Dolphin deny knowledge of the games as investigators pursue the suspect.
